Awareness of some daily habits can help you lose weight easily. Certain habits are done without thinking, but are not calorie effective at all. In fact, without the knowledge which I am about to share with you, you may even wonder why you are not losing weight. You have been good all week at watching your calorie intake and exercising. So why is that that when you have committed yourself to do well and have a good week, the scale does not reflect your effort?
One of the reasons could be that you are drinking a lot of calories everyday without being aware of their high caloric content. Walter Willett, M.D., chairman of the nutrition department at the Harvard School of Public Health in Boston, Mass., and co-author of "Eat, Drink and Be Healthy" (Simon & Schuster, 2002) brings the attention to this knowledge. As he mentions, “Fruit juices, coffee drinks and regular soda are liquid calories that don't yield much satiety. An 8-ounce regular soda contains 103 calories; the same amount of orange juice has 110. And this does not even include alcoholic beverages which are generally high in calories and are not easy to say no to, after the first glass of wine or beer. One coffee drink can have 300 calories.” This is definitely food for thought or should we say “drink for thought”.
Take a quick assessment of all the drinks you had today or yesterday. How many calories do you think they accounted for? Does this shock you? If so, that is okay. Now you know where these “empty” calories are coming from and you can do something about it.
Your next step would be to decide on which drinkable calories you are going to cut down on as part of your success weight loss program. In my book, nothing is taboo. If you make something taboo, the chances are quite high that you will most probably crave it even more. So you do not have to cut these things out of your eating plan completely, but limiting them might be a great idea. For example I would not cut out your favorite glass of wine with your loved one on your regular Friday night date. Nor would I suggest you miss out on your delicious cappuccino with your friends on Sunday mornings. These are occasions that hold special value to you and are important in your life. Juts remember, nothing has to be taboo – HOW you work it into your success program is what will count at the end of the day.
So for today, decide on what drinkable calories you would like to cut down on and how much of it you want to limit. Be specific in order to set yourself up for a winning week. If you are like me, who likes both hot and cold drinks, choose low- or no-calorie beverages such as herbal teas, water, coffee without cream or sugar, seltzer and skim milk. A cup of chamomile tea before going to bed will not only help with your weight loss, but will give you good nights sleep too.
